What's The Definition Of Transmission line?

transmission line in American English
noun: a system of conductors, as coaxial cable, a wave guide, or a pair of parallel wires, used to transmit signals

transmission line in British English
noun: a coaxial cable, waveguide, or other system of conductors that transfers electrical signals from one location to another

transmission line in Electrical Engineering
noun: A transmission line is a system of conductors that transfers electrical signals from one place to another.
